Pistons vs. Pelicans odds, line, spread, time: 2025 NBA picks, March 23 predictions from proven model
We've got another exciting interconference contest on Sunday's NBA schedule as the Detroit Pistons will host the New Orleans Pelicans. Detroit is 39-32 overall and 18-16 at home, while New Orleans is 19-52 overall and 7-29 on the road.
Tipoff is set for 3 p.m. ET from Little Caesars Arena in Detroit, Mich. The Pistons are favored by 11.5 points in the latest Pelicans vs. Pistons odds, according to the SportsLine consensus. The over/under is 230.5 points. Detroit is at -575 on the money line (risk $575 to win $100), with New Orleans at +420 (risk $100 to win $420).
